The Wine and D.O. Trade Fair draws 18 pct more visitors this year

Over 11,000 people have visited the 8th Wine and Designations of Origin Trade Fair, offering four days of intense business and academic activity at the Torremolinos Exhibition and Conference Centre. This number of visitors –18pct more than the previous year– was much higher than expected.

The Costa del Sol is visited by a new group of Russian travel agents

The Costa del Sol Tourist Board has recently welcomed a new group of 22 travel agents from Russia marketing Natalie Tours products and services. Just like the one before it, this fam trip was organised in response to a request made by incoming agency Viatges Serhs Hotels.

Hotel Occupancy Rate – September 2007

In September 2007, 504,036 travellers stayed in accommodation facilities on the Costa del Sol. This is 8.52 pct more than in September 2006, when the region’s hotels accommodated 464,466 guests.

The Costa del Sol Tourist Board attends 2nd Health Tourism Meeting

On 25 and 26 October, representatives of the Tourist Board attended the 2nd Health Tourism Meeting in Marbella, organised by the Andalusian Association of Residential, Sports and Health Tourism Companies (PROMOTUR), with the help of VITANIA and Valle Romano.

Nuestra Señora de la Encarnación Church

The minaret of the Nuestra Señora de la Encarnación Church (Our Lady of the Incarnation) stands alone as Árchez’s monument par excellence. It is a well-preserved 15th-century building and it was declared a national monument in 1979. It is 15 metres high and has a square base of 3.64 x 3.64 metres.
